Technical Parameters of LM2793LDX

Type:DC DC Regulator
Topology:Switched Capacitor (Charge Pump)
Internal Switch(s):Yes
Voltage - Supply (Min):2.7V
Voltage - Supply (Max):5.5V
Voltage - Output:-
Current - Output / Channel:16mA
Frequency:500kHz
Dimming:PWM
Applications:Backlight
Operating Temperature:-30~C ~ 85~C (TA)
Mounting Type:Surface Mount
Package / Case:10-WFDFN Exposed Pad
Supplier Device Package:10-WSON (3x3)
